ILC Little do you know what lies behind that solid door. As it opens, your eyes quickly scan the entire room, but nothing grabs your attention. A closer look re- veals en- closing, drab walls, no win- dows and cold fluorescent light. You are ushered to one of twenty solitary carrolls that boast a view of the blank, discolored wall. This is your domain from 7:45 AM to 3:00 PM for a one, three, or five day habitude. You live there, you work there, you eat lunch there, you exist there. For seven hours you work on assignments from teachers. You have no other com- munication whatsoever, save that of the constant hum of the lights. You are constantly monitored. Your be- havior, your aca- d e m I c progress, your every movement is scrutin- ized by a silent, grim-faced teacher who never wants to see you again. During that long, arduous, boring, seven-hour period you decide that nothing is worth the ex- perience you found behind the closed door.
